Obituary

Steven Lee Reed, 62, of Bauxite, Arkansas was born on Wednesday, March 13th, 1963, in Lake Village, Arkansas, and he entered heaven on Tuesday, March 17th, 2025. He brought smiles to everyone by telling jokes and making people laugh.

Steven was a hard worker and  worked for Semcoa Bauxite Mining for 13 years. Steven was known for his kind heart and infectious smile. He had a passion for the Razorbacks on Saturdays and the Cowboys on Sundays. He also enjoyed fishing, playing horseshoes, and spending time with his grandkids! His ability to light up a room will be deeply missed. Steven worked for Semcoa Bauxite Mining for 13 years

Steven leaves behind cherished memories with family and friends. He is preceded in death by his son, Donald Higgins; his mother, Vernice "Snooter'' VanStory Reed; father, Ken Reed;  and grandparents, Oscar and Nelly Reed and Joe "Poppy" Van Story and Ellen "Doodie."  Boyd VanStory; He is survived by his wife, Janet Reed; two daughters, Jennifer Duncan and Taylor Skarda; brothers, Bruce (Brenda) and Scott (Holly); sister, Susan (Wayne); nine grandchildren, Jessica, Allen, Magen, Julia, Macy, Zack, Zoie, Braxton, and Hagan; three great-grandchildren, Teagan, Charlotte, and Faelynn; and numerous nieces and nephews and family and friends.

A celebration of Steven's life will be held on Saturday, March 29th, 2025, at 2:00 P.M. at Wrights Chapel Church, followed by a potluck in his honor.
